For advanced manufacturing training, LabVolt offers simulation capabilities in industrial controls, allowing students to design, program, and troubleshoot Programmable Logic Controllers (PLCs) in a safe virtual environment.

The LabVolt Simulator (LVSIM-EMS) is an essential digital tool in modern technical education. By combining the fidelity of physical LabVolt hardware with the convenience of web-based technology, it provides an invaluable learning experience that prepares students for the challenges of the energy sector.
